快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
创建一个Sublime Text中文版效率测评工具,自动记录并比较常见开发任务完成时间:1)中文文档编辑 2)代码重构 3)多文件搜索。工具应生成可视化报告,对比Sublime Text中文版、VS Code和Atom的表现。包含内存占用、启动速度、中文渲染准确性等指标。- 点击'项目生成'按钮,等待项目生成完整后预览效果
作为一名长期使用各种代码编辑器的开发者,最近在InsCode(快马)平台上做了一个有趣的实验:对比Sublime Text中文版与VS Code、Atom在中文开发环境下的效率差异。这个测评工具完全在浏览器里完成,不需要安装任何软件,特别适合快速验证不同编辑器的实际表现。
测评工具设计思路为了客观比较三款编辑器,我设计了三个典型的中文开发场景测试项:中文文档编辑(含混合代码)、批量变量重命名重构、跨项目全局搜索。工具会记录每个操作的耗时、内存变化和CPU占用率,最终生成带图表的数据报告。
中文渲染准确性测试在测试中文文档编辑时,特别关注了以下几点:
- 中英文混排时光标定位是否准确
- 不同字号下的汉字显示清晰度
- 特殊符号(如全角括号)的自动配对
输入法候选框跟随效果
性能指标对比方法使用系统API实时监测:
- 冷启动到可操作耗时
- 打开20MB中文日志文件的速度
- 同时打开10个代码文件时的内存占用
执行全局查找替换时的CPU峰值
代码重构效率实测模拟了实际开发中最常见的重构场景:
- 批量重命名中文命名的变量
- 提取重复代码为函数
调整包含中文注释的代码格式 发现Sublime Text中文版在语法分析时对中文标识符的处理更精准。
多文件搜索体验针对中文代码库特别测试了:
- 搜索含中文路径的文件速度
- 正则表达式匹配中文内容
搜索结果预览的渲染效率 Atom在超大项目搜索时出现了明显的卡顿。
可视化报告生成测试数据通过D3.js生成交互式图表,包含:
- 三种编辑器各项指标的雷达图对比
- 操作耗时曲线图
- 内存占用柱状图 支持导出为PNG或分享网页链接。
- 意外发现在测试过程中注意到:
- VS Code的中文插件会显著增加启动时间
- Sublime Text中文版的默认字体优化更适合长时间阅读
Atom的汉字输入延迟在三者中最明显
优化建议根据测试结果总结的提升效率技巧:
- 对中文项目关闭不必要的语法检查
- 调整自动补全的触发延迟
- 为不同语言设置专属的渲染配置
这个测评项目最让我惊喜的是,整个工具从开发到部署都是在InsCode(快马)平台上完成的,不需要配置本地环境就能实时看到数据变化。特别是部署功能,一键就把测试报告变成了可分享的网页,省去了折腾服务器的麻烦。
实测证明,对于中文开发者来说,Sublime Text中文版在响应速度和资源占用方面确实有优势,特别是处理大型中文项目时差异更明显。不过VS Code的扩展生态和Atom的开源性也各有适用场景。建议开发者根据项目特点灵活选择,或者像我一样用这个测评工具实际验证下哪个更适合自己的工作流。
快速体验
- 打开 InsCode(快马)平台 https://www.inscode.net
- 输入框内输入如下内容:
创建一个Sublime Text中文版效率测评工具,自动记录并比较常见开发任务完成时间:1)中文文档编辑 2)代码重构 3)多文件搜索。工具应生成可视化报告,对比Sublime Text中文版、VS Code和Atom的表现。包含内存占用、启动速度、中文渲染准确性等指标。- 点击'项目生成'按钮,等待项目生成完整后预览效果